const isExists = function(object, path) { let parts = []; if(isString(path)) { parts = path.split('.'); } else if(isFilledArray(path)) { parts = path; } let testObject = object; for(let i = 0, end = parts.length; i < end; i++) { if(isScalar(testObject) || typeof(testObject[parts[i]]) === 'undefined') { return false; } testObject = testObject[parts[i]]; } return true; }; const getValue = function(object, path, defValue) { let parts = []; if(isString(path)) { parts = path.split('.'); } else if(isFilledArray(path)) { parts = path; } let testObject = object; for(let i = 0, end = parts.length; i < end; i++) { if(isScalar(testObject) || isNoValue(testObject) || typeof(testObject[parts[i]]) === 'undefined') { return defValue; } testObject = testObject[parts[i]]; } return testObject; } const isNoValue = function(value) { return value === undefined || value === null; } const isString = function(value) { return typeof(value) === 'string'; } const isNumeric = function(value) { return typeof(value) === 'number'; } const isBoolean = function(value, smart = false) { return typeof(value) === 'boolean' || (smart && ['yes', 'on', 'true', '1', 'no', 'off', 'false', '0'].indexOf(String(value).toLowerCase()) > - 1); } const isTRUE = function(value) { return value === true || ['yes', 'on', 'true', '1'].indexOf(String(value).toLowerCase()) > -1; } const isScalar = function(value) { return ['object', 'undefined'].indexOf(typeof(value)) === -1; } const TYPES = Object.freeze({ SCALAR: 1, EMPTY: 2, ARRAY: 3, OBJECT: 4, UNKNOWN: 5 }); const getType = function(value) { if(isScalar(value)) { return TYPES.SCALAR; } else if(isNoValue(value)) { return TYPES.EMPTY; } else if(isArray(value)) { return TYPES.ARRAY; } else if(isPlainObject(value)) { return TYPES.OBJECT; } return TYPES.UNKNOWN; } const isArray = Array.isArray ? Array.isArray : function(value) { return Object.prototype.toString.call(value) === '[object Array]'; } const isFilledArray = function(value) { return isArray(value) && value.length; } const isPlainObject = function(value) { return Object.prototype.toString.call(value) === '[object Object]'; } const isFilledPlainObject = function(value) { return isPlainObject(value) && Object.keys(value).length; } const isFunction = function(value) { return typeof(value) === 'function'; } const onlyProps = function(object, onlyProps) { const result = {}; if(isFilledPlainObject(object) && isFilledArray(onlyProps)) { Object.keys(object).forEach(prop => { if(onlyProps.indexOf(prop) > -1) { result[prop] = object[prop]; } }); return result; } return null; } const randomString = function(len = 10) { let text = ''; const charset = "ab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QRSTUVWXYZ0123456789"; for(let i = 0; i < len; i++) { text+= charset.charAt(Math.floor(Math.random() * charset.length)); } return text; } const sort = function(keys) { return keys.sort((a, b) => { const aNum = Number(a); const bNum = Number(b); const aIsNum = !isNaN(aNum) && a.trim() !== ""; const bIsNum = !isNaN(bNum) && b.trim() !== ""; // 1. If both numeric → compare numerically if (aIsNum && bIsNum) { return aNum - bNum; } // 2. If one numeric and one string → numeric comes first if (aIsNum && !bIsNum) return -1; if (!aIsNum && bIsNum) return 1; // 3. compare as strings (binary-safe, case-sensitive) if (a < b) return -1; if (a > b) return 1; return 0; }); } module.exports = { isExists, getValue, isScalar, isString, isNumeric, isBoolean, isNoValue, isFunction, isArray, isFilledArray, isPlainObject, isFilledPlainObject, isTRUE, onlyProps, randomString, getType, sort, TYPES }
